Cannot switch to agent mode

Yesterday day while working IN AGENT MODE I started getting responses in the chat saying that commands cannot be executed because I need to switch to Agent Mode. I tried switching ask and then going back but it still Agent mode stays grayed out. I’m new to this so I don’t know if it’s something I did/clicked inadvertently or if it’s an issue with Cursor…. Need help, my project has come to a standstill…

Hi @George_Hillman would it be possible for you to share a screenshot or replicate somehow for example using a loom?

Here’s a screenshot. Notice that it’s in the middle of a chat where Agent mode is working fine, then it’s not. Notice the Agent button - should it be highlighted or is that normal? What would make Cursor not be able to see that it’s still in Agent mode?

Hey, thanks for the screenshot. It really helped. I can clearly see the issue. The Agent button is selected at the bottom of the chat, but the model thinks it’s in Ask mode.

The fastest fix is to open a new chat Cmd+I and make sure Agent is selected before you send the first message. That usually fixes the state mismatch. Continuing in a chat where this already happened usually won’t help. It won’t fix itself.

If it keeps happening even in new chats, try fully restarting Cursor (Cmd+Q, then open it again).

Can you share your Cursor version? (Cursor menu > About Cursor, top left.) The team is tracking this issue, and your report with the screenshot really helps with prioritizing it.

Let me know if creating a new chat gets you unblocked.